Before we can make any choice, we must gather information from the environment about what our options are. This information-gathering process is critically mediated by attention, and our attention is, in turn, shaped by our previous experiences with—and learning about—stimuli and their consequences. In this review we highlight studies demonstrating a rapid and automatic influence of reward learning on attentional capture, and argue that these findings provide a human analogue of sign-tracking behaviour observed in non-human animals – wherein signals of reward gain incentive salience and become attractive targets for attention (and overt behaviour) in their own right. We then consider the implications of this idea for understanding the drivers of cue-controlled behaviour, with focus on addiction as a case in which choices with regard to reward-related stimuli can become injurious to health. We argue that motivated behaviour in general—and addiction in particular—can be understood within a ‘biased competition’ framework: different options and outcomes compete for attentional priority as a function of top-down goals, bottom-up salience, and prior experience, and the winner of this competition becomes the target for subsequent outcome-directed and flexible behaviour. Finally, we outline the implications of the biased-competition framework for cognitive, behavioural, and socioeconomic interventions for addiction.
